| 3845 |
idir |
1 |
import {utils} from './WidgetsSaisiesCommun.js';
|
|
|
2 |
import {WidgetsSaisiesASL} from './WidgetsSaisiesASL.js';
|
|
|
3 |
import {ReleveASL} from './ReleveASL.js';
|
|
|
4 |
import {PlantesEtLichensASL} from './PlantesEtLichensASL.js';
|
|
|
5 |
|
|
|
6 |
export const initialiserModule = function(nomSquelette = 'arbres') {
|
|
|
7 |
const proprietes = $( '#zone-' + nomSquelette).data();
|
|
|
8 |
switch( nomSquelette ) {
|
|
|
9 |
case 'plantes' :
|
|
|
10 |
case 'lichens' :
|
|
|
11 |
const plantesEtLichens = new PlantesEtLichensASL(proprietes);
|
|
|
12 |
|
|
|
13 |
plantesEtLichens.init();
|
|
|
14 |
break;
|
|
|
15 |
case 'arbres' :
|
|
|
16 |
default :
|
|
|
17 |
const arbres = new ReleveASL(proprietes);
|
|
|
18 |
arbres.init();
|
|
|
19 |
break;
|
|
|
20 |
}
|
|
|
21 |
};
|
|
|
22 |
|
|
|
23 |
$( document ).ready( function() {
|
|
|
24 |
// InitialisationASL.prototype = new WidgetsSaisiesCommun(widgetProp);
|
|
|
25 |
const widget = new WidgetsSaisiesASL();
|
|
|
26 |
widget.init();
|
|
|
27 |
|
|
|
28 |
utils.init();
|
|
|
29 |
});
|